We start off, in strictly alphabetic order with Békéscsaba 1912 Előre SE:
"Békéscsaba 1912 Előre SE is a football (soccer) club from the south-east Hungarian town Békéscsaba. The club was founded in 1912 as Előre Munkás Testedző Egyesület. The colours of the club are lilac and white. The club achieved its greatest success in 1988 when it won the Hungarian Cup competition, defeating Honved Budapest 3-2 in the final." (Wikipedia)
"Until the end of 2004/05 the club spent a total of 25 seasons in the first Hungarian division, the Nemzeti Bajnokság I.. In the season 2008/09 the club is part of the second division, the NB II." (Wikipedia)
The team plays in a 13.000 seats stadium, the Stadion Kórház Utcai.
"On 4 December 2013, it was announced that Békéscsaba 1912 Előre SE will have 800 million HUF to spend on the reconstruction of the stadium.
On 16 December 2014, according to the Magyar Közlöny Békéscsaba 1912 Előre SE will have 1 billion 125 million HUF to spend on the reconstruction of the new stadium. In 2015, 565 million HUF were assigned for the reconstruction" ( Wikipedia )
